OEHmedia: Palm Valley, Cape Byron Headland
OEHmedia: Palm Valley, Cape Byron Headland
OEHmedia: Palm Valley, Cape Byron Headland
OEHmedia: Palm Valley, Cape Byron Headland
OEHmedia: Palm Valley, Cape Byron Headland
OEHmedia: Palm Valley, Cape Byron
OEHmedia: Palm Valley, Cape Byron